package com.gallatinsystems.notification.dao;
import java.util.Date;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import javax.jdo.PersistenceManager;
import com.gallatinsystems.framework.dao.BaseDAO;
import com.gallatinsystems.framework.servlet.PersistenceFilter;
import com.gallatinsystems.notification.domain.NotificationHistory;
import com.gallatinsystems.notification.domain.NotificationSubscription;
/**
* saves and finds NotificationSubscriptions from the datastore
*
* @author Christopher Fagiani
*/
public class NotificationSubscriptionDao extends
BaseDAO<NotificationSubscription> {
public NotificationSubscriptionDao() {
super(NotificationSubscription.class);
}
/**
* lists all unexpired notifications (where expiryDate <= sysdate) and
* NotificationSubscriptionType == type
*
* @return
*/
public List<NotificationSubscription> listUnexpiredNotifications(String type) {
return listSubscriptions(null, type, true);
}
/**
* lists all subscriptions
*
* @param entityId
* @param type
* @return
*/
@SuppressWarnings("unchecked")
public List<NotificationSubscription> listSubscriptions(Long entityId,
String type, boolean unexpiredOnly) {
PersistenceManager pm = PersistenceFilter.getManager();
javax.jdo.Query query = pm.newQuery(NotificationSubscription.class);
Map<String, Object> paramMap = null;
StringBuilder filterString = new StringBuilder();
StringBuilder paramString = new StringBuilder();
paramMap = new HashMap<String, Object>();
appendNonNullParam("notificationType", filterString, paramString,
"String", type, paramMap);
appendNonNullParam("entityId", filterString, paramString, "Long",
entityId, paramMap);
if (unexpiredOnly) {
appendNonNullParam("expiryDate", filterString, paramString, "Date",
new Date(), paramMap, GTE_OP);
query.declareImports("import java.util.Date");
}
query.setFilter(filterString.toString());
query.declareParameters(paramString.toString());
return (List<NotificationSubscription>) query.executeWithMap(paramMap);
}
/**
* finds the notification history record (if it exists) for this type/entity combination
*
* @param type
* @param entityId
* @return
*/
@SuppressWarnings("unchecked")
public NotificationHistory findNotificationHistory(String type,
Long entityId) {
PersistenceManager pm = PersistenceFilter.getManager();
javax.jdo.Query query = pm.newQuery(NotificationHistory.class);
Map<String, Object> paramMap = null;
StringBuilder filterString = new StringBuilder();
StringBuilder paramString = new StringBuilder();
paramMap = new HashMap<String, Object>();
appendNonNullParam("type", filterString, paramString, "String", type,
paramMap);
appendNonNullParam("entityId", filterString, paramString, "Long",
entityId, paramMap);
query.setFilter(filterString.toString());
query.declareParameters(paramString.toString());
List<NotificationHistory> results = (List<NotificationHistory>) query
.executeWithMap(paramMap);
if (results != null && results.size() > 0) {
return results.get(0);
} else {
return null;
}
}
/**
* saves the notification history object passed in, incrementing the count and updating the date
* before saving.
*
* @param h
* @return
*/
public static synchronized NotificationHistory saveNotificationHistory(
NotificationHistory h) {
if (h != null) {
if (h.getCount() == null) {
h.setCount(1L);
} else {
h.setCount(h.getCount() + 1);
}
h.setLastNotification(new Date());
NotificationSubscriptionDao dao = new NotificationSubscriptionDao();
h = dao.save(h);
}
return h;
}
}
